SQL Server模板资源管理器是简化数据库创建的实用工具,通过提供预设模板库,帮助用户快速生成符合需求的数据库结构,无论新手还是资深开发者,均可直观选择模板(如通用业务、数据分析等类型),并自定义表、字段、索引等参数,无需手动编写复杂脚本,该工具不仅降低操作门槛,还确保数据库规范性,大幅提升创建效率,是优化数据库开发流程的得力助手。
在数据库管理与开发中,创建标准化的数据库结构是提升效率、确保一致性的关键步骤,SQL Server作为主流的关系型数据库管理系统,提供了强大的模板资源管理器工具,帮助用户通过预设模板快速生成数据库脚本,简化手动编写复杂SQL语句的过程,本文将详细介绍如何利用模板资源管理器创建数据库,从基础操作到自定义模板,助你掌握这一实用技能。
模板资源管理器概述:什么是模板资源管理器?
模板资源管理器是SQL Server Management Studio(SSMS)内置的一个工具窗口,用于存储、管理和复用数据库对象(如数据库、表、视图、存储过程等)的T-SQL脚本模板,它相当于一个“脚本库”,用户可以直接调用内置模板,或自定义符合业务需求的模板,避免重复编写相似代码,尤其适合需要批量创建标准化数据库的场景(如开发环境初始化、测试数据库部署等)。
核心优势
- 标准化:通过统一模板确保数据库结构(如表字段类型、约束、索引等)符合规范,减少人为差异。
- 高效性:无需从零编写脚本,直接基于模板修改参数,快速生成创建语句。
- 可复用:自定义模板可保存为团队共享资源,提升协作效率。
使用模板资源管理器创建数据库:详细步骤
前提条件
- 已安装SQL Server并配置好SSMS(建议版本:SQL Server 2016及以上)。
- 具备连接到SQL Server实例的权限(至少需要
CREATE DATABASE权限)。
步骤1:启动SSMS并连接到SQL Server实例
打开SSMS,在“连接到服务器”对话框中输入服务器名称、身份验证信息(Windows身份验证或SQL Server身份验证),点击“连接”。

步骤2:打开模板资源管理器
在SSMS菜单栏中,点击“视图”→“模板资源管理器”(或按快捷键Ctrl+Alt+T),右侧将显示模板资源管理器窗口,模板资源管理器默认按“数据库”、“表”、“视图”等类别组织,数据库”类别下包含内置的数据库创建模板(如“新建数据库”)。
步骤3:选择并使用内置模板
- 定位模板:在模板资源管理器中展开“数据库”节点,找到“新建数据库”模板(默认路径:
数据库→新建数据库)。 - 生成脚本:双击“新建数据库”模板,SSMS将自动在查询编辑器中打开对应的T-SQL脚本(默认内容如下):
USE [master] GO CREATE DATABASE [数据库名] ON PRIMARY ( NAME = N'数据库名', FILENAME = N'数据文件路径.mdf', SIZE = 5120KB, MAXSIZE = UNLIMITED, FILEGROWTH = 10%) LOG ON ( NAME = N'数据库名_log', FILENAME = N'日志文件路径.ldf', SIZE = 1024KB, MAXSIZE = 2048GB , FILEGROWTH = 10%) GO ALTER DATABASE [数据库名] SET ANSI_NULLS ON GO ALTER DATABASE [数据库名] SET QUOTED_IDENTIFIER ON GO ALTER DATABASE [数据库名] SET ALLOW_SNAPSHOT_ISOLATION ON GO ALTER DATABASE [数据库名] SET READ_COMMITTED_SNAPSHOT ON GO ALTER DATABASE [数据库名] SET MULTI_USER GO
步骤4:修改脚本参数
根据实际需求修改脚本中的关键参数:
- 数据库名:将
[数据库名]替换为目标数据库名(如SalesDB)。 - 文件路径:修改
FILENAME中的路径(如D:\SQLData\SalesDB.mdf和D:\SQLData\SalesDB_log.ldf),确保目录存在且有写入权限。 - 文件大小与增长方式:调整
SIZE(初始大小)、MAXSIZE(最大容量)、FILEGROWTH(增长量),例如将初始大小设置为10240KB(10MB),增长方式改为1024KB(固定增长)。 - 兼容性选项:默认脚本已包含常用数据库设置(如
ANSI_NULLS、QUOTED_IDENTIFIER等),可根据需求增删。
步骤5:执行脚本创建数据库
- 检查脚本无误后,点击查询编辑器工具栏的“执行”按钮(或按
F5),SSMS将提交T-SQL语句到SQL Server执行。 - 执行成功后,在“对象资源管理器”中刷新服务器节点,即可在“数据库”下看到新创建的数据库(如
SalesDB)。
自定义数据库模板:打造专属模板库
当内置模板无法满足复杂需求(如需要预设表结构、存储过程或特定配置)时,可通过自定义模板实现个性化复用。
步
文章版权声明:除非注明,否则均为xmsdn原创文章,转载或复制请以超链接形式并注明出处。

